Butt Hinges

Butt hinges are a versatile type of traditional door hinge that is used in a variety of projects, including door hinges for cabinets, gate hinges and window shutters. They are easily found at the hardware store near you and are easy to install. They are an excellent choice for those who prefer a more traditional look and require a strong hinge that can take the weight of heavy materials.

The main purpose of butt hinges is to aid in the swinging motion needed for opening and closing doors, gates, lids, windows, cabinets and more. They are one of the most common kinds of hinges due to their versatility and durability. When selecting butt hinges, there are some things to think about.

To ensure that the hinges are properly fitted it is necessary to first determine the dimensions of each hinge plate. Once you know the size, you will be able to mark the places where screw holes must be drilled into the surface where the hinge will be fixed. Make sure that the holes are located at equal distances from each other so that they will be properly aligned after they are put in place. It is recommended to insert the hinge pin after drilling the holes to test the fit. If the hinges do not fit, you can adjust them to make sure they are snug.

Butt hinges, aside from being durable and strong they also are more affordable and require less maintenance than other hinges. They are able to withstand repeated use and heavy loads which makes them a great choice for both residential and commercial applications. Additionally, they are available in various sizes and finishes which allows you to select the one that best suits your requirements.

For the best results, you must be sure to lubricate your hinges on a regular basis to reduce friction between the plates and minimize wear and tear. Lubrication will also help extend the lifespan of your hinges. You can do this using an oil that is light like WD-40 to lightly coat the moving parts of your hinges. You should also clean the hinges in order to remove dirt and prevent the formation of rust.

Flag Hinges

Often seen on more modern doors, flag hinges feature sleek, subtle appearance and double glazed window hinge knuckle feature that effectively combats door droop. They are designed to be attached directly to the reinforcing of the leaf of the door which makes them more secure than butt hinges, and permitting them to reach PAS 24 as part of a complete door assembly.

Flag hinges come in a variety plate and pin sizes. The size of the hinge has an impact on its durability and strength. In general larger plates and pins are able to support more weight. This makes them ideal for doors with heavier weights.

To attach the flag hinges first drill the screw holes and pin-locating holes into the 3 hinge positions on the door sash. Then, place the flag bushes inside each of the sash pieces and tap them in with the mallet made of rubber. Fit the frame piece onto the door frame by aligning the locating screws with the hinge bush before screwing it into position.

Check that the sash has been properly installed and make any adjustments that are required. The sash should be positioned in the middle of the frame, and the centre gravity should be evenly distributed between the hinges that are on the outer edges.

Make sure you choose a model that has an anti-lift device in it to give you peace of mind. This will guard your sash from intruders and keep them from forcing or lifting the sash after closing. This kind of hinge may also be ordered with a stainless-steel pin for greater security.

A cast hinge is created by casting metal and is among the most reliable and oldest manufacturing processes. A pattern made of metal, wood, or plastic is packed with sand and then placed in a flask to make the cast-hinge. The sand is then removed leaving a gap within which liquid metal can be poured. Once solid, the hinge will be ready to be installed.

A hinge is composed of two plates that are typically made from steel and have a pin running through them. The pin is used to secure the hinges into place and joining them together. Each hinge plate has ridges or tabs that lock with the other plate to form a 'knuckle', and it is this that binds the hinge.

The flat plates of the hinge have holes in them that are used to fix the hinge to the door or frame. The hinges are typically screwed into the corresponding hole to ensure a secure, durable connection that won't break or break off with time.

They are the most popular hinges for uPVC exterior and interior doors. They feature pins and knuckle plates, and can be fitted with roller bearings or a ball for greater durability. The hinges are available in a range of sizes to suit most standard doors, and are able to be fitted with left- and right-handed hinges for simple installation.

This type hinge can be fitted on systems with profile that feature ovolo or chamfer features, which make it difficult to use traditional butt hinges. With an adjustable euro rebate hinge plate these Mila Evolution hinges fit directly into the sash's grove of euro and fold around the door sash to fit their needs, making them suitable as a replacement hinges for upvc windows for a variety of old hinges fitted over the years. They are also available in brown and white to fit the majority of euro rebate positions. They can be adjusted with the twin adjustment screws that come with the hinges.

Installation

The quality of the hinges used on uPVC doors and aluminium windows hinges has a major effect on their performance. A good quality hinge helps to create a tight seal and increases insulation, thereby helping to reduce energy costs. It can also help create a quieter environment and ensures a smooth operation of the windows. Apart from these advantages, high-quality hinges also provide aesthetic appeal to the window. They come in a variety of designs and finishes that can be matched with various architectural designs.

Replacing uPVC window hinges is a fairly straightforward task that can be accomplished by the most skilled DIYers. First, remove the existing hinges by removing them using an screwdriver. Be careful not to force them off as this could cause damage to the frame or door. After the hinges have been removed, mark the areas where you'd like to put the new hinges. You'll have to know the orientation of the window and, for hinges with restrictors the handing. Additionally, you'll need to know the hinge size and track's outer width.

After you have taken your measurements, you can choose the right uPVC hinges. Follow the instructions on the internet or on the instructions sheets that come with each kind of hinge. Attach the hinges using supplied screws. Before tightening the hinges it is crucial to ensure that they are in alignment. You should also lubricate your hinges with a silicone based lubricant to increase their smoothness.
